Abstract

Leptospirosis, a paradigm of a One Health disease, mostly imposes its high burden on vulnerable farmers or poor urban active young males in tropical and subtropical regions. Based on the environmental and climatic determinants of leptospirosis, there is strong evidence to suggest that this high burden will increase further in the future, as a consequence of climate change.
